浮点数prev_float()是一个浮点类方法,它返回浮点数的先前表示形式。
用法: float.prev_float()
参数:要传递的浮点值
返回:浮点数的先前表示形式。
范例1:
# Ruby code for prev_float() method
# Initializing value
a = 26.00/ 3
b = 8.0999
c = 3 + 105.003
# Printing Result
puts "previous Floating Point Number:#{a.prev_float}\n\n"
puts "previous Floating Point Number:#{b.prev_float}\n\n"
puts "previous Floating Point Number:#{c.prev_float}\n\n"
输出:
previous Floating Point Number:8.666666666666664 previous Floating Point Number:8.099899999999998 previous Floating Point Number:108.00299999999999
范例2:
# Ruby code for next_float() method
# Initializing value
a = 26.00
b = 8.0
# Printing result
puts "previous Floating Point Number:#{a.next_float}\n\n"
puts "previous Floating Point Number:#{b.prev_float}\n\n"
输出:
previous Floating Point Number:26.000000000000004 previous Floating Point Number:7.999999999999999
相关用法
- Ruby Float eql()用法及代码示例
- Ruby Float arg()用法及代码示例
- Ruby Float zero?()用法及代码示例
- Ruby Float quo()用法及代码示例
- Ruby Float nan?()用法及代码示例
- Ruby Float next_float()用法及代码示例
- Ruby Float numerator()用法及代码示例
- Ruby Float divmod()用法及代码示例
- Ruby Float angle()用法及代码示例
- Ruby Float rationalize()用法及代码示例
- Ruby Float absolute()用法及代码示例
- Ruby Float phase()用法及代码示例
- Ruby Float positive()用法及代码示例
- Ruby Float fdiv()用法及代码示例
- Ruby Float denominator()用法及代码示例
注:本文由纯净天空筛选整理自mayank5326大神的英文原创作品 Ruby Float prev_float() method with example。非经特殊声明,原始代码版权归原作者所有,本译文未经允许或授权,请勿转载或复制。